Transaction 0398639d1e43e90b1c1e1698a34caaf9f812fd07ea80285616ad3885bedbcb0a

2 Input
2 Outputs
  • 0398639d1e43e90b1c1e1698a34caaf9f812fd07ea80285616ad3885bedbcb0a:0
  • value  5600000000
    address  35PvCDw34pvZwisfpheUUEyAts5feZF2ee
  • 0398639d1e43e90b1c1e1698a34caaf9f812fd07ea80285616ad3885bedbcb0a:1
  • value  11282560341
    address  1Jc6iXBUQXimvKmt8Sxf2v4R3rYmtSv7wQ